Commit Graph

192 Commits

Author SHA1 Message Date
YunaiV 7ef86c14c0 WfForm =》BpmForm 2021-12-30 20:23:50 +08:00
YunaiV 4b2af44ee3 Merge branch 'master' of https://gitee.com/zhijiantianya/ruoyi-vue-pro into feature/activiti
 Conflicts:
	sql/ruoyi-vue-pro.sql
	yudao-admin-server/src/main/resources/application.yaml
	yudao-admin-server/src/main/resources/mybatis-config/mybatis-config.xml
	yudao-framework/yudao-spring-boot-starter-security/src/main/java/cn/iocoder/yudao/framework/security/core/LoginUser.java
	yudao-framework/yudao-spring-boot-starter-security/src/main/java/cn/iocoder/yudao/framework/security/core/util/SecurityFrameworkUtils.java
2021-12-30 19:58:31 +08:00
YunaiV 67aaf28832 code review 退款逻辑 2021-12-30 09:08:11 +08:00
chen quan d556eae556 优化 支付配置校验方式,优化业务层异常抛出类型,优化支付应用渲染逻辑,添加删除支付商户 支付应用的校验,退款订单去除reqNo字段,支付订单去除 channelExtras 参数展示 2021-12-29 19:49:29 +08:00
jason 08103685f1 重构退款逻辑,去掉退款后处理 2021-12-28 17:10:25 +08:00
YunaiV bcc2ff0f5b code review 退款逻辑 2021-12-25 20:40:49 +08:00
YunaiV cea1589e79 code review 支付渠道的逻辑 2021-12-25 19:09:39 +08:00
YunaiV c916b30fa1 Merge branch 'master' of https://gitee.com/zhijiantianya/ruoyi-vue-pro into pay_extension
 Conflicts:
	sql/ruoyi-vue-pro.sql
	yudao-admin-server/src/main/resources/application.yaml
	yudao-admin-server/src/test/resources/sql/clean.sql
	yudao-admin-server/src/test/resources/sql/create_tables.sql
	yudao-admin-ui/src/utils/dict.js
	yudao-user-server/src/main/resources/application-local.yaml
2021-12-16 09:45:50 +08:00
YunaiV a92acff99b 1. 升级 1.3.0-snapshot 版本
2.【修复】biz-data-permission 组件的缓存机制,导致部分 SQL 未进行数据过滤
2021-12-16 07:19:52 +08:00
YunaiV abf61bfdea 修复引入多租户后,前端 <img /> 读取图片报错的问题 2021-12-15 13:08:15 +08:00
YunaiV a55c0cfca5 Merge branch 'master' of https://gitee.com/zhijiantianya/ruoyi-vue-pro
 Conflicts:
	yudao-core-service/pom.xml
	yudao-dependencies/pom.xml
	yudao-framework/pom.xml
2021-12-15 10:07:21 +08:00
YunaiV 9d97c0ccb4 yudao-spring-boot-starter-data-permission 和 yudao-spring-boot-starter-tenant 调整为 biz 组件 2021-12-15 10:06:02 +08:00
YunaiV 712067979c Merge branch 'master' of https://gitee.com/zhijiantianya/ruoyi-vue-pro into feature/user-social
 Conflicts:
	yudao-admin-server/src/main/java/cn/iocoder/yudao/adminserver/modules/system/service/auth/impl/SysAuthServiceImpl.java
	yudao-admin-server/src/test/java/cn/iocoder/yudao/adminserver/modules/system/service/auth/SysAuthServiceImplTest.java
	yudao-dependencies/pom.xml
	yudao-framework/pom.xml
	yudao-user-server/src/main/java/cn/iocoder/yudao/userserver/modules/system/service/auth/impl/SysAuthServiceImpl.java
2021-12-15 09:26:47 +08:00
YunaiV b365b40273 code review 用户社交登陆的逻辑
增加测试页面的 README.md
2021-12-15 09:18:15 +08:00
YunaiV 098c5b4723 1. 管理后台,增加租户管理
2. 修复大量因为租户报错的单元测试
2021-12-14 22:39:43 +08:00
YunaiV 619a7b73c3 增加 DeptDataPermissionRuleTest 单元测试 2021-12-14 00:34:42 +08:00
YunaiV 8278b65777 重构 Dept 数据权限逻辑,统一收到 yudao-spring-boot-starter-data-permission 包下 2021-12-13 09:27:46 +08:00
YunaiV 986cb72421 基于部门的数据权限 2021-12-13 00:28:20 +08:00
YunaiV b0855cc626 实现 DataPermissionRuleFactoryImpl,并增加相关单测 2021-12-12 11:55:30 +08:00
YunaiV f9b15fe70d 1. 增加数据权限的自动配置 DataPermissionAutoConfiguration
2. 增加数据权限的 AOP DataPermissionAnnotationInterceptor
3. 重命名 DataPermissionDatabaseInterceptor
2021-12-12 00:56:16 +08:00
YunaiV 2334e177c5 1. 引入 mockito-inline
2. 优化【数据权限】的单元测试
2021-12-11 15:38:20 +08:00
YunaiV 3fbd394653 完善数据权限的单元测试 2021-12-11 13:17:02 +08:00
YunaiV 0f792c64e7 通过 MyBatis Plus 数据权限的单测 2021-12-11 11:16:45 +08:00
YunaiV e9385219c2 数据权限的逻辑处理,暂未测试 2021-12-11 08:54:49 +08:00
YunaiV eda2b11dad 增加数据权限的 SQL 重写的上下文 2021-12-10 10:08:29 +08:00
YunaiV e9ba4ac705 初始化 DataPermission 的模型 2021-12-08 10:15:48 +08:00
YunaiV c99115abe7 初始化数据权限模块 2021-12-07 21:28:16 +08:00
YunaiV 814c2db65c 初始化数据权限模块 2021-12-07 21:19:23 +08:00
YunaiV 4b95146c98 设置实体继承多租户的 DO 2021-12-07 13:31:59 +08:00
YunaiV 8795a4cdeb 增加 Tenant Security 的实现 2021-12-06 13:25:33 +08:00
YunaiV df9b06843f 增加 Tenant Redis 的实现 2021-12-06 10:18:36 +08:00
YunaiV 1ce2c09f47 增加 Tenant MQ 的支持 2021-12-06 01:32:41 +08:00
YunaiV a231582637 增强 mq starter 组件,支持 interceptor 拦截器机制 2021-12-05 23:50:17 +08:00
YunaiV d29b0beb9b 优化 mq starter 组件,增加 RedisMQTemplate 模板类 2021-12-05 23:00:41 +08:00
YunaiV ade55d89a4 多租户,接入 Spring Async 机制 2021-12-05 17:59:58 +08:00
YunaiV 6cd9b3bf7e 1. 增加 Job 的多租户的能力 2021-12-05 10:44:17 +08:00
YunaiV 7c8fe2fc50 1. 增加 yudao-spring-boot-starter-tenant 租户的组件
2. 改造 UserDO,接入多租户
2021-12-04 21:09:49 +08:00
YunaiV 2da6a746e4 增加个人信息的加载 2021-11-26 09:47:23 +08:00
jason f108d478a8 调整渠道支付通知地址为统一的地址 2021-11-24 23:54:16 +08:00
aquan 1c5544fc9d 优化渠道 config 校验和逻辑转换问题 2021-11-24 11:51:06 +08:00
jason dfde260ebb 支付宝退款申请通知 2021-11-22 16:22:46 +08:00
jason 444ba79822 修改code review 2021-11-21 22:33:42 +08:00
YunaiV f0fcf4798e code review 支付的逻辑 2021-11-21 21:11:07 +08:00
aquan 6069a387ea 优化完善支付应用和支付渠道代码逻辑,完善单元测试,基于validator完成手动校验config 2021-11-21 19:37:16 +08:00
YunaiV b32ac09ddf code review 工作机的流程 2021-11-21 12:59:52 +08:00
YunaiV b18cd457c8 code review 支付相关的代码实现 2021-11-21 12:24:08 +08:00
YunaiV d405f4df25 修复单元测试报错的问题 2021-11-21 11:12:47 +08:00
jason 7d6f205dc0 支付退款申请,支付宝手机wap 相应实现 2021-11-21 11:12:32 +08:00
yunlong.li cfdf04981a fix: 新增工作流模型 2021-11-17 18:48:40 +08:00
ouyang 19f554176c tina提交支付宝扫码单元测试 2021-11-15 16:51:38 +08:00
YunaiV 3368a995ca 支付模块的 code review 2021-11-10 09:40:09 +08:00
YunaiV e969dbe8b7 工作流的 code review 2021-11-10 09:11:29 +08:00
aquan e46a27b937 完成支付模块支付应用信息和微信类型的支付渠道配置。 2021-11-09 16:36:07 +08:00
yunlong.li 848913bf2f fix: 代码 review 修改 2021-11-08 14:24:31 +08:00
YunaiV 1bc4bdac0c 工作流的 code review 2021-11-07 20:25:31 +08:00
timfruit 13a9405082 增加注释,优化代码 2021-11-05 23:14:51 +08:00
yunlong.li 3c3f46ee4e fix:[工作流] 返回对应实例的流程图 2021-11-05 17:13:55 +08:00
YunaiV 6265e4a736 支付的 code review 2021-11-05 08:10:07 +08:00
jason 26798a8816 修改code review 2021-11-05 00:10:32 +08:00
ouyang 461c6a0007 tina提交支付宝扫码支付 2021-11-04 14:27:36 +08:00
YunaiV 6cadafb3f1 code review 支付宝 wap 的逻辑 2021-11-04 08:47:41 +08:00
jason 2c60a3aafa 支付宝手机网站支付 2021-11-04 00:46:24 +08:00
YunaiV aa77eb029f 增加支付宝 QR 支付的回调 2021-11-03 09:05:04 +08:00
YunaiV 696e94a1a3 解决 pay 参数校验报错的问题 2021-11-03 08:42:38 +08:00
YunaiV 396f3a6dff Revert "akarta.validation-api =》jakarta.el 依赖,保证 EL 不报错"
This reverts commit 1b336c7df6.
2021-11-03 08:38:45 +08:00
YunaiV 1b336c7df6 akarta.validation-api =》jakarta.el 依赖,保证 EL 不报错 2021-11-02 08:23:15 +08:00
YunaiV 65abc667b0 code review 社交登陆相关的代码 2021-11-02 08:12:37 +08:00
YunaiV c186d279ba code review 工作流的相关代码 2021-11-02 07:56:05 +08:00
jason f26c17cff0 修改code review 2021-10-31 22:11:55 +08:00
timfruit 8aa45406fd 拓展授权登录抽取成单独的starter,拓展配置和默认配置齐平 2021-10-31 13:09:55 +08:00
YunaiV 722eaf3513 调整下工作流的包名 2021-10-31 09:55:12 +08:00
YunaiV 742125ed99 code review 工作流的代码
合并最新的 SQL
2021-10-30 13:46:39 +08:00
YunaiV 0050b1e46d Merge branch 'master' of https://gitee.com/zhijiantianya/ruoyi-vue-pro into feature/activiti
 Conflicts:
	yudao-dependencies/pom.xml
	yudao-framework/pom.xml
2021-10-30 10:24:58 +08:00
YunaiV c89accbf06 完成支付通知的逻辑 2021-10-27 13:22:49 +08:00
YunaiV dd2d8a2ba9 优化支付通知的逻辑,解决并发的问题。
同时,收到支付结果时,立马回调业务,避免延迟
2021-10-27 10:06:49 +08:00
YunaiV 4acada62d3 完成支付回调的逻辑 2021-10-26 09:50:18 +08:00
YunaiV 75633aa84b 增加微信公众号的支付回调接口 2021-10-25 23:29:42 +08:00
YunaiV 20628987c9 增加支付回调地址的配置 2021-10-25 09:56:49 +08:00
YunaiV 44f357cea4 接入 weixin-mp-java ,编写相关示例。 2021-10-24 11:53:42 +08:00
YunaiV ab19228ca6 完成支付的下单和提交订单的逻辑 2021-10-23 20:14:13 +08:00
jason 436781507e merge master change 2021-10-23 19:16:00 +08:00
YunaiV 6dc65234ef 增加支付相关表的 SQL,调整相关的实体 2021-10-23 17:47:27 +08:00
YunaiV 6e3aa8a752 完善 PayClientFactoryImpl 的实现,增加创建 PayClient 的方法 2021-10-23 14:00:02 +08:00
YunaiV 1ed6656bbb 完成对微信公众号支付的封装 2021-10-23 11:00:36 +08:00
YunaiV 23d8da7479 完善 AbstractPayClient 的实现 2021-10-20 13:20:09 +08:00
YunaiV 6690b9b120 完善支付宝的 AlipayPayClient 的实现 2021-10-20 08:27:44 +08:00
YunaiV 7ca756a234 引入支付宝的支付功能 2021-10-19 09:26:49 +08:00
YunaiV 24f4fd4fee 完成支付单的单体轮廓 2021-10-19 07:41:45 +08:00
YunaiV 81126b2b4b 1. 引入 IJPay 组件
2. 增加创建支付单的 Service 实现
2021-10-18 09:41:38 +08:00
jason ee8dcd0888 1.实现了工作流引擎 中 请假流程demo(定义在 resources/leave.bpmn)
2.增加一个一级菜单 OA 办公 下面两个菜单: 请假申请,待办任务
3.暂时不知如何找部门领导, 暂时写死为 admin
4.activity 用户组使用 用户岗位来代替。
5.新增一个用户 hradmin, 密码 123456  岗位是 人力资源
6.演示流程。
  a. admin 登陆 申请请假
  b. admin 待办任务(审批)
  c. hradmin 登陆 待办任务(审批)
  d. admin 登陆 待办任务 (确认)
2021-10-13 23:43:03 +08:00
YunaiV 5133cd0fdf Merge branch 'master' of https://gitee.com/zhijiantianya/ruoyi-vue-pro into pay_extension 2021-10-12 21:25:03 +08:00
QingChen 60b528e80e 支付核心 2021-10-12 10:42:17 +08:00
QingChen 8070afc807 支付核心 2021-10-12 10:41:34 +08:00
YunaiV 043c05a083 修复阿里云短信,无法发送的问题 2021-10-12 09:24:58 +08:00
YunaiV d784b113af 将 login_log、error_log 迁移到 yudao-core-service 项目中 2021-10-10 18:49:39 +08:00
YunaiV 5b723d02b2 增加 yudao-core-service 模块,提供共享逻辑 2021-10-10 01:34:31 +08:00
wangwenbin10 28fdc8e42e 初始化 c 端的登录逻辑 2021-10-09 08:24:17 +08:00
YunaiV 4e93efdb9b 完成 SysSocialServiceTest 的绑定用户的单测 2021-10-09 08:02:14 +08:00
wangwenbin10 b139107717 初始化 c 端的用户相关的表 2021-10-08 08:30:28 +08:00
YunaiV 6686ded18b 修复 admin 服务的全局登录的拦截 2021-10-07 22:26:03 +08:00